The creature takes the form of a clown named Pennywise and lures children into its grasp, before ultimately […] WebOct 13, 2024 · Why does Pennywise eat children? According to It, when humans got scared, “all the chemicals of fear flooded the body and salted the meat”. This is why he prefers to feast on children — their fears are simple, pure, and powerful compared to the complex, pathological fears of adults. Basically, children are delicious. horns of elfland
